SPOT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

391 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Spotify (SPOT)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$14.5B — up 42% from $10.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 87 funds opened new SPOT positions and 59 closed out — a net gain of 28 holders — while 128 added to existing stakes and 118 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$1.28B. The largest seller was TPG Group Holdings (SBS)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$143M sold.
